iLEAD Lancaster 7th Graders Launch Mycology Project

iLEAD Lancaster 7th Grade Mycology Project

iLEAD Lancaster 7th graders have officially launched their mycology project, and the excitement is contagious! Through this immersive experience, they’re not just studying biology; they’re diving deep into challenges our world is facing, all through the incredible lens of mycology.

Plus, we had special guests! iLEAD Lancaster’s DreamUp Launch Team Space Mushroom joined in the presentation, sharing their firsthand experience in mycology and sending oysters mushrooms to the International Space Station to determine how mycelium grows in microgravity.
